    JAX 3.0???

    In 2019-20, JAX started the season as the #2 center behind Derrick Favors (even starting when Favors went out in November) before losing his job to Jahlil Okafor.

    In 2020-21, JAX started the season as the #2 center behind Stephen Adams before losing his job to Billy H'Gomez.

    In 2021-22, JAX has started the season as the #2 center behind Jonas Valciunas, but has performed miserably while his minutes have been miniscule.

    I have long said that there were three players on this team who I consider untouchable....Zion, BI, and JAX, because of his athleticism and potential. (I also said in his rookie year that JAX was so raw, that he should be sent to Erie to learn the game.) Now that we are three years into the 2019 draftees' careers, I feel compelled to say that there is now only one player on the team who I consider untouchable.
